LATV Springs Forward With New Prime-Time Lineup

Tagged: , , , , , , , , , , , , ,

“LATV, the nation’s first bilingual music/entertainment network distributed via digital multicast, announced today its new spring programming lineup which will premiere March 17. The bilingual multicast network, which recently announced its 30th national affiliation, is premiering a bi-weekly entertainment talk show, a daily celebrity biopic, a spoof on television, classic concerts and music videos with text messaging overlay to its programming lineup.

"As our national reach grows, so does the scope of LATV's programming.
With our new VP Programming Luca Bentivoglio on board, we are expanding our
offerings to include a wider range of what we're known for --
ground-breaking, bilingual shows," said Danny Crowe, president, LATV.

    LATV's expanded fare will feature numerous new hosts of Mexican, Puerto
Rican and Cuban heritage. The spring lineup includes:

    -- En la Zona (Tues., Thurs., 6:00 p.m. PT; 9:30 p.m. PT).  En la Zona (In
       the Zone) will delve into the latest trends in music, film, fashion and
       glamour.  The 30-minute entertainment program will be headlined by LATV
       host Viviana Vigil and telenovela star Pili Montilla.  In addition,
       there will be a guest host each episode. Silvia Olmeda, who currently
       has a TV show on Mexico City's "TeleHit," joins the cast the first
       week.
    -- Classic en Concierto (Wed., Fri., 6:00 p.m. PT; Fri., 9:30 p.m. PT)
       Julieta Venegas, La Ley and Soraya are among the artists featured in
       this music hall of LATV fama.
    -- Texty Videos. (Mon. - Fri., 7:00 p.m. PT) Alexis de la Rocha hosts this
       one-hour interactive forum for text messages while introducing the
       latest videos.
    -- Verdad y Fama. (Mon. - Fri., 8:00 p.m. PT) These one-hour biopics
       feature personalities from the world of entertainment, sports, music
       and film.  From Juan Gabriel, Pepe Aguilar and Paulina Rubio to soccer
       star Cuauhtemoc Blanco and wrestling sensation Rey Misterio, Verdad y
       Fama (Truth and Fame) goes in-depth into their lives and work.
    -- Wachale. (Premieres: Wed., March 26, 6:00 p.m. PT.) Hosted by Humberto
       Guida, Wachale (Take a look) is a half-hour weekly show that spoofs
       Latino television and pop culture.

    "LATV is an original, with a singular approach to programming that
reaches our viewers, taps into their thoughts and delivers alternative TV.
We have a great team that is constantly thinking and creating what our
viewers want to see," says Mr. Bentivoglio. "This spring's lineup reflects
the interactive, controversial and hip component that viewers expect."

    LATV currently has 30 affiliations across the country in 16 of the top
25 Hispanic television markets. LATV is also carried on basic cable through
its affiliates and in Los Angeles on KJLA via cable, broadcast and DBS.
